What is Unzip in Python?
Python’s built-in shutil
module provides a function called unpack_archive()
, which allows you to extract the contents of an archive file, such as ZIP or TAR. This process is commonly referred to as ‘unzipping’ or ‘extracting’.
To use this feature in Python, you’ll need to import the shutil
module and then call the unpack_archive()
function with the path to your archive file.
Here’s an example of how you can do it:
“`
import shutil
archive_path = ‘path/to/your/archive.zip’
destination_folder = ‘/path/to/extracted/files’
shutil.unpack_archive(archive_path, destination_folder)
“`
This code will extract the contents of the specified ZIP file to the designated folder.
Why Use Python for Unzipping?
Python is a popular programming language known for its simplicity and ease of use. When it comes to unzipping files, Python’s shutil
module provides an efficient way to extract archive contents without requiring any additional software or dependencies.
Conclusion
In this article, we’ve explored the basics of unzipping files with Python using the built-in shutil
module. By following our step-by-step guide and examples, you can easily integrate file extraction into your Python projects.
For more information on AI-powered chatbots like ChatCitizen, visit: https://chatcitizen.com